What Can I Learn From Bhutan

admin   /   July 1, 2022


Nestled amongst the mighty Himalayas and between swift-flowing rivers and deep valleys, lies Bhutan. It’s one of the world’s tiniest countries with a population of slightly less than 700,000. Having said that, Bhutan’s commitment to conservation, happiness and sustainability beats most of the remaining world. So much so that we could all justifiably learn a great deal from this small, otherworldly country.

Here are key essentials of a fulfilling life that you can learn from Bhutan:

  1. Happiness is everything

Do you know the reason behind the Bhutanese radiating happiness? It’s the Gross National Happiness (GNH) philosophy of the country.

This guiding force of the Bhutanese Government prioritises its peoples’ wellbeing and happiness in the development index. Gross National Happiness is of such high importance to the country that even the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) doesn’t stand a chance before it.

  1. Act with Compassion

Through Buddhism, the country’s main religion, the Bhutanese have made the religious beliefs a way of life.  So, they naturally practice compassion towards all live beings, which Buddhism highly values.

  1. Care for the Environment

The Bhutanese urge for protecting their flora and fauna stems from their traditional respect for nature. Moreover, it’s a Bhutan Constitution mandate to perpetually preserve at least 70 per cent of the country’s land under forest cover.

Consequently, Bhutan is carbon negative, producing more oxygen than it consumes. What’s more, the clean and fresh Bhutan air helps resist the world’s climate change, thus contributing appreciably to a cleaner planet.

  1. Get back to basics.

The Bhutanese have strong advocacy to retain their unique, ancient culture. Their simple habit of relying on each other teaches us the sheer joy of pure and uninterrupted human interaction. Be it a sporting event or festive gathering, the people of Bhutan always fall back on their basic traditions of camaraderie.
